The purpose of this research study is to learn more about how sugar levels in the liver affect the ability of people both with and without type 1 diabetes. People with type 1 diabetes do not make their own insulin, and are therefore required to give themselves injections of insulin in order to keep their blood sugar under control. However, very often people with type 1 diabetes give themselves too much insulin and this causes their blood sugar to become very low, which can have a negative impact on their health. When the blood sugar becomes low, healthy people secrete hormones such as glucagon and epinephrine (i.e., adrenaline), which restore the blood sugar levels to normal by increasing liver glucose production into the blood. However, in people with type 1 diabetes, the ability to release glucagon and epinephrine is impaired and this reduces the amount of sugar the liver is able to release. People with type 1 diabetes also have unusually low stores of sugar in their livers. It has been shown in animal studies that when the amount of sugar stored in the liver is increased, it increases the release of glucagon and epinephrine during insulin-induced hypoglycemia. In turn, this increase in hormone release boosts liver sugar production. However, it is not known if increased liver sugar content can influence these responses in people with and without type 1 diabetes. In addition, when people with type 1 diabetes do experience an episode of low blood sugar, it impairs their responses to low blood sugar the next day. It is also unknown whether this reduction in low blood sugar responses is caused by low liver sugar levels. The investigators want to learn more about how liver sugar levels affect the ability to respond to low blood sugar.

Study VBT00002 is planned to be a Phase 1/2, randomized, modified double-blind, active-controlled, multi-center study to be conducted in approximately 980 adults aged 50 years and older in the United States. The purpose of the study is to assess the safety and immunogenicity of recombinant influenza vaccine (RIV) + adjuvanted recombinant COVID-19 vaccine (rC19) vaccine comprised of RIV combined with different recombinant Spike (rS) antigen levels of rC19 compared to RIV alone, rC19 (dose 1) alone, and RIV and rC19 (dose 1) (coadministered in opposite arms). Placebo will be coadministered in the RIV alone, rC19 (dose 1) alone, and RIV + rC19 study groups to control for the number of injections and to maintain observer blinding. Thus, each participant will receive two injections at enrollment, one in each deltoid muscle. Study details include: * The study duration will be approximately 12 months * Study intervention will be administered via a single intramuscular (IM) injection into the right and left deltoid muscles on Day(D) 01 * Dose escalation with sequential enrollment (sentinel cohort followed by main cohort for a given dose) * The visit frequency for participants will be D01 and D30, and D09-D366 (telephone call) Number of Participants: Approximately 980 participants are expected to be randomized.

Frequently Asked Questions

How much do clinical trials in Kentucky pay?

Each trial will compensate patients a different amount, but $50-100 for each visit is a fairly common range for Phase 2–4 trials (Phase 1 trials often pay substantially more). Further, most trials will cover the costs of a travel to-and-from the clinic.

How do clinical trials in Kentucky work?

After a researcher reviews your profile, they may choose to invite you in to a screening appointment, where they'll determine if you meet 100% of the eligibility requirements. If you do, you'll be sorted into one of the treatment groups, and receive your study drug. For some trials, there is a chance you'll receive a placebo. Across trials in Kentucky 30% of clinical trials have a placebo. Typically, you'll be required to check-in with the clinic every month or so. The average trial length in Kentucky is 12 months.

How do I participate in a study as a "healthy volunteer"?

Not all studies recruit healthy volunteers: usually, Phase 1 studies do. Participating as a healthy volunteer means you will go to a research facility in Kentucky several times over a few days or weeks to receive a dose of either the test treatment or a "placebo," which is a harmless substance that helps researchers compare results. You will have routine tests during these visits, and you'll be compensated for your time and travel, with the number of appointments and details varying by study.

What does the "phase" of a clinical trial mean?

The phase of a trial reveals what stage the drug is in to get approval for a specific condition. Phase 1 trials are the trials to collect safety data in humans. Phase 2 trials are those where the drug has some data showing safety in humans, but where further human data is needed on drug effectiveness. Phase 3 trials are in the final step before approval. The drug already has data showing both safety and effectiveness. As a general rule, Phase 3 trials are more promising than Phase 2, and Phase 2 trials are more promising than phase 1.

Do I need to be insured to participate in a medical study in Kentucky ?

Clinical trials are almost always free to participants, and so do not require insurance. The only exception here are trials focused on cancer, because only a small part of the typical treatment plan is actually experimental. For these cancer trials, participants typically need insurance to cover all the non-experimental components.
